Ralph Waldo Emerson once said, “Do not go where the path may lead, go instead where there is no path and blaze trails.” This quote was meant to challenge people to rise above the status quo and go beyond what is expected or even anticipated; it is a mantra, Ms. Kezia M. Williams has followed since 2002 when she first became committed to being politically involved.

Kezia M. Williams is a native of Richmond, Virginia and proud alum of Christopher Newport University (CNU), where she received her Bachelor of Arts degree in political science and journalism. Currently, she works as a senior analyst for CENTRA Technology. She also works as President of her company, Intimate Arrangements, LLC, an event planning for couples (www.intimate-arrangements.com).

In addition to working full time, Kezia is deeply committed to public service and subscribes fully to the concept of servant leadership. Most recently Ms. Williams was appointed National Events Director for a politically and civically-engaged nonprofit organization. In this role, she managed the operations of over 16 national committees located in seven different cities and worked with approximately 100 volunteers to achieve strategic goals and objectives. She was also instrumental in raising over $150,000 in small contributions from donors nationwide in less than 90 days. She achieved this monumental accomplishment by starting with a strong vision and zero-dollar budget.

Kezia has also served as a community organizer for Generation Obama-Washington, DC, where she was instrumental in mobilizing over 200 volunteers in the District of Columbia and Northern Virginia to become politically engaged by making phone calls, knocking on doors, planning events, and hosting rallies during the 2008 presidential elections.

Kezia was also the youngest member to serve as a commissioner for the City of Alexandria’s Human Rights Commissioner (2005 – 2008) and the first Director of Political Engagement for the Northern Virginia Urban League, Young Professionals Network (2005-2007). She is also a member of the Alexandria Chapter of the National Association for the Advancement of Colored People (NAACP) and a political columnist with emPower magazine.

Kezia also writes for her own blog, Politics, Power and Pumps (www.politicspowerandpumps.blogspot.com).

Kezia has over nine years of political event planning and fundraising experience, a skill she began developing in 2003 after founding a campus chapter of the NAACP at CNU.

As founder of the Capital Cause, Ms. Williams hopes to see the organization develop a new generation of donors dedicated to supporting local nonprofits financially and through public service.
